Swansway reports profit of £14.4m

Swansway Motor Group has reported profit of £14.4 million in its financial results for 2023, which following a goodwill amortisation of £1 million, resulted in a pre-tax profit of £13.4 million. The financial result reflects strength despite the cost-of-living crisis and increased interest rates. Used values decline despite robust first quarter

April saw average car values at the three-year, 60,000-mile point, decline by 1.5% (c. £300). This decline follows an overall rise in values of 0.5% over Q1, reflecting a softening in demand and an increase in supply.
